In her incredible Spring 2025 runway show, Mowalola collaborated with the iconic brand from the archives of the aughts, bringing Miss Sixty back on the radar of cool people who get it.

Mowalola has been disrupting the fashion sphere for a while now. Her and her fly girl group, consisting of Deto Black and Chi, slay severely in an extremely refreshing way.
Childhood friends from Lagos, Deto & Mowa have risen to stardom as successful multi-hyphenates. While Mowalola took to fashion, Deto Black rocks the underground scene with her unique Nollypop sound. Nollypop being the fan-coined name for her Nigerian pop genre.

From collaborating with Yeezy to produce the iconic $30 exclusive 'WET' tank (that I totally own, DUH!), to her most recent partnership with Rimowa, Mowalola knows what's hot and fun and fresh and DIFFERENT.
